Is 957 907 a perfect square number?

A number is a perfect square (or a square number) if its square root is an integer; that is to say, it is the product of an integer with itself. Here, the square root of 957 907 is about 978.727.

Thus, the square root of 957 907 is not an integer, and therefore 957 907 is not a square number.

What is the square number of 957 907?

The square of a number (here 957 907) is the result of the product of this number (957 907) by itself (i.e., 957 907 × 957 907); the square of 957 907 is sometimes called "raising 957 907 to the power 2", or "957 907 squared".

The square of 957 907 is 917 585 820 649 because 957 907 × 957 907 = 957 9072 = 917 585 820 649.

As a consequence, 957 907 is the square root of 917 585 820 649.
